[QUOTE="aramis erak, post: 9178894, member: 6779310"] I'm well over 250. Traveller alone, given CT, MT, TNE, T4, and MGT1, plus some third party stuff for CT and MGT, pushes a hundred. (CT alone, no 3rd parties, is at least 50.) Traveller is, of need, across two crates. I've a bunch of FASA-Trek - half a crate in with later Trek, and the rest in a smaller tub, because they were gifted to me by someone while the crate was still in a different state. I suspect I'm close to 1000 physical books, most of which are game related. I keep them organized by system in milk crates (from defunct dairies). One crate is nothing but Dune novels and McCaffrey novels, all in hardcover. Just in my current LoS are 35 NOT in use; two will see no use, either... the Marvel playtest and TOR 2e Collector Ed. The TOR 2e Starter Box has been opened, to put in the replacement dice... and looked through. Not going to see use, either. Just out of LoS, a crate of WFRP1e, with all of TEW in the consolidations, 4 of the 6 Doomstones volumes, the companion, both apocrypha volumes. Also, all 3 current volumes of ALien, plus the adventures, and Blade Runner and its starter, oh, and vaesen and the first adventure book. Plus, under the notebook, one of my hardcover D&D Rules Cyclopedia. (I've at least one more, maybe even 2 or 3 more. But they're in the storage along with most of the D&D Gazeteers.) THis doesn't count boxed non-RPGs, either. Counting the two non-game books, we add a bible, a dozen manuals for various pieces of tech... So, in my bedroom, about 50 books. And that's maybe 20%, if even that much, of the book count. I organize my PDFs into folders by system, and if the system is used in multiple games, those are in subfolders; a few get cross-linked - STA is in the top level, but has symlinks in both the 2d20 and Trek folders.
